Output 14388a6ae446d7decf58964682851dfc49d1ad49661faaa8fd147aebcc8bc55a:18

value
309108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70bf86bd3fba8708ae5300d558baccc82f6f5484 OP_EQUAL
address
3ByB3WbhgjafQ2JQu2Z3qCz3tF4eMQyjVq
transaction
14388a6ae446d7decf58964682851dfc49d1ad49661faaa8fd147aebcc8bc55a